Two people, including one from Ingersoll were arrested this morning in a stolen vehicle in Thames Centre.
INGERSOLL - OPP tracked down a stolen vehicle on Evelyn Drive this morning around 1:47 in Thames Centre.
Multiple officers performed the traffic stop, one of the cruisers was damaged during the arrest.
Both occupants of the vehicle were arrested.
A 46 year old from Wiarton was charged with dangerous operation, flight from police and possession of property obtained by crime under $5,000.
A 31 year old from Ingersoll was also arrested and charged with property obtained by crime under $5,000.
